History & Origin
Rooted in the Latin word for just and lawful, Justus came into German use as a name signalling uprightness. It has a long scholarly pedigree — chemist Justus von Liebig, a founding figure of modern chemistry, bore it in the nineteenth century.
Related forms appear across Europe, including the French Juste, Italian Giusto, Lithuanian Justas, and Spanish Justo. Actor Justus von Dohnányi is a modern German bearer.

Frequently Asked
What does the name Justus mean?
Justus is usually explained as meaning 'just, lawful, upright' and is most often linked with German tradition.
How do you pronounce Justus?
It's commonly said JUHS-tuhs /ˈd͡ʒʌs.təs/.
Is Justus a boy or girl name?
In this batch and in recent U.S. usage data, Justus is used as a boy name.
How popular is Justus?
In 2024, Justus ranked #1807 in the U.S. for boys, with 90 births recorded.
